    Default Re: CHANGING COPYRIGHT STATUS IN FILE BROWSER?

    You need to

    1.) Open a file

    2.) Choose File Info

    3.) In the Description panel, choose Copyrighted as the Copyright Status (and optionally, enter the copyright notice and/or url.

    4.) From the unlabelled flyout menu at the top right of the dialog box, choose Save Metadata Template.

    5.) In the File Browser, select all the images to which you want to apply the Copyrighted status.

    6.) From the File Browser's Edit menu, choose Append Metadata, and pick the template you saved in step 4.

    Photoshop will then add the Copyrighted status to all selected images.
